Palmdale Fire Claims 2nd Young Victim

A second child has died from injuries suffered in a fire that swept through a Palmdale home last week, a Sheriff’s Department spokeswoman said Wednesday.

Joseph Jacobo, 4, died at 8:46 p.m. Saturday at Childrens Hospital Los Angeles after suffering severe smoke inhalation, Deputy Sonia Parra said.

The boy’s 6-year-old sister, Rochelle Fuentes, died in the Feb. 20 fire at the children’s grandparents’ house in the 38700 block of Stanridge Avenue.

Another sibling, 3-year-old Jacob Jacobo, who was taken to the hospital in critical condition, has been upgraded to fair condition, a hospital spokesman said.

Their uncle, Nathan Maropulos, 22, remained in critical condition after undergoing surgery at Grossman Burn Center in Sherman Oaks, hospital spokesman Larry Weinberg said.

Maropulos had third-degree burns over 25% of his body and severe smoke inhalation.

The cause of the fire remains under investigation.
